12:57 am
like couple ross hanson and diane erdmann. what stood out to you? >> it was very hard to figure out. all the other scams have been a little easier. we kind of knew where to look. what stood out to me about that episode is that it is kind of a hunt. >> ross hanson and diane erdmann ran northwest territorial mint, a bullion business that sold precious metals like gold and silver coins. the only catch the business turned out to be bogus. the couple running a ponzi like scheme, defrauding thousands of customers out of more than $30 million. lacey sitting down with key characters piecing together the scheme. >> jay young, former cfo at northwest territorial mint, saw it all go down. if there's anyone who can help connect the dots, it's him. >> we have. >> been getting so many complaints from customers about gold and silver shipments being delayed that i thought, there's got to be something here. why are we not shipping this out? >> i got lucky with the people
12:58 am
that we sat down with. this one is complicated. it took a lot of work to deconstruct, and i think that's really necessary for people who might be susceptible to scams. because if you're a really high, intelligent person, you might meet a scammer who has your bait. that will just throw a lot of complicated things into the point where you can't dissect them. >> hanson and erdman were eventually convicted on more than a dozen counts of fraud. hanson was sentenced to 11 years in federal prison and erdman to five. did any part of you, as you were going through this scam, be like, yeah, of course this happened to you. you gave all your gold to this person? >> no, because i understood why. >> you understood. >> that was the trend of the time. and everyone's always looking for financial protection. don't nobody want to be down bad when the economy sinks. y'all just let this man
